I'm not sure how long it takes to remove them, but to paint 3-4 coats. then clear coat 3-4 coats (if you want clear coat) could be done in one day over the weekend if you really wanted to do it. I did 4 coats lens tint then 4 coats clear coat on all 4 of my side markers in one weekend, the second day was just to install them back on.... just saying, if you want to do it for under $10 it can be done. if it comes bad, just put them back on until new ones come in.... PS all you need is 15-20 minutes between black coats. If you use clear coat wait 2 hours after last black coat, then 15-20 minutes between clear coats.... Should take 2 hours if just paint, 5-6 hours if clear coat is used.....
